Kuta to Gili Islands

If you’re spending the bulk of your vacation in Kuta, Bali, chances are that you’d doubt things could get any better. But there is a special excursion that could make your trip even more memorable. Consider travelling from Kuta to Gili Islands. The Gili Islands are a group of three tiny islands that are renowned for their calm turquoise waters, powder soft white sands, and coconut palms. They truly are a picture of paradise. Now, Kuta is already a relatively exclusive destination. It’s the only airport is only recently built and, though now fully operational, is nowhere near as busy as Bali’s main airport and the places that it flies out to are limited. So, if you want to access the Gili Islands, you’re going to have to look for alternative means of transport to a flight. One option is to book a private car and speedboat package. The private car will pick you up from Kuta and drive you to Teluk Nare Harbour (around a two-hour drive), where a speedboat will be waiting to take you on a five to ten-minute ride across the Gili Islands. If you are hesitant to take a speedboat, an alternative option is to go to Senggigi, where you can take a fast boat to Gili Islands. Sure, this may sound like a fair bit of travel for a day trip, but the islands that await are more than worth your patience.

Hurghada to Cairo

Hurghada in Egypt is a stunning coastal town that has been built from the ground up with tourists in mind. Stunning hotels line the seafront and there are plenty of excursions such as swimming with wild dolphins, glass bottom boats, and dune buggies through the nearby desert to keep you occupied. However, if you want a truly cultural experience, consider a day trip to Cairo. This will take you to see the great wonder of Ancient Egypt, including the world-renowned Pyramids of Giza and Sphinx. Now, this trip entails a six-hour coach ride, however, this coach leaves in the early hours of the morning when you would usually be asleep and you can always get your head down and wake up in Cairo as opposed to your hotel room. Alternatively, flights are available at a slightly higher cost!
